What brings QB Payroll Error PS060?
QB Payroll error PS060 is a type of error that obstructs the smooth working of QB Payroll.. Several reasons that are thought for the appearance of this issue are:-
When Intuit’s server goes down.
If still with the older form of QuickBooks, as Intuit won’t support the old form of Payroll.
When the third party security observes QB experience of Intuit as a threat. The QuickBooks might have been blocked.
While conducting a full system scan to remove virus & malware.
Efficient approaches to Fix QuickBooks Payroll Error PS060
Stick to the given steps carefully to repair QB PS060 Payroll error:-
Make Adjustments in Billing & Subscription settings
Firstly, Open “My Account”
Select the company to Edit & make alterations.
Now, go to Billing & click on the Edit option.
Check & Verify all the corrections & modifications.
Click save & close to any or all the adjustments made.
Preview it for confirmation.
Now save the changes made.
Download the most recent QB Payroll version.
Using an old version could possibly be a cause of the problem. To resolve it, quickly download the latest form of QB Payroll.

Hold Back for server Response
Sometimes, Intuit servers go down or there could be some issues in it. Therefore, it’s simpler to pause for sometime until everything would go to a normal state.
